What you can add

Open any badge in the editor and switch to the Stickers tab. You'll find two new sections:

  • Shapes — square, circle, triangle, diamond, pentagon, hexagon, star and heart. Perfect for badges, frames, banners and accents.
  • Icons — a curated library of 150+ icons across celebrations, school, weather, food, animals, music, travel and more: birthday cake, gift, party popper, graduation cap, trophy, medal, crown, snowflake, sun and moon, pizza, hearts, paw prints, rockets and dozens more.

Every shape and icon behaves the same way: drag to move, drag a corner to resize, rotate, and recolour it — and it prints razor-sharp because it's drawn as crisp vector art, not a low-resolution image.

How to add a shape or icon (step by step)

  1. Open your badge. In the Template Studio, upload a photo (or start from a blank badge) and hover it, then click ✏️ Edit.
  2. Go to the Stickers tab. Shapes and icons now live here (alongside your PNG sticker uploads).
  3. Add a shape by tapping one of the shape buttons, or add an icon by tapping any icon in the grid — it drops straight onto the badge.
  4. Position it. Drag it where you want, drag a corner handle to resize, and use the rotate handle to angle it.
  5. Style it. With the shape/icon selected, set its line colour, fill colour and line width. Turn fill on for a solid look, or keep it as a clean outline.

That's it — a few taps and your badge has a professional decorative accent.

Tips for the best results

  • Keep it simple. One or two icons usually reads better than a crowded badge.
  • Match your colours. Recolour icons to your badge's rim or theme colour for a cohesive look.
  • Mind the trim. Keep important icons inside the inner guide so nothing important is cut off.
  • Combine with text and QR. Pair an icon with curved text or a QR code for badges that inform as well as decorate.
